surra trypanosomiasis of domestic animals, e.g., equines, camels, elephants, pigs, goats, and dogs, caused by Trypanosoma evansi, usually transmitted by tabanid flies; common signs include fever, anemia, edema, progressive emaciation and weakness, and death. It occurs in East Asia, the Middle East, North Africa, and Central and South America; in the latter regions it is usually seen in horses, is spread by vampire bats as well as flies, and is called murrina or derrengadera.
